China Pushes AI Revolution in Manufacturing 🔥🤖

China's annual Two Sessions meetings are fueling big plans for the future of AI—and it's all about supercharging the manufacturing sector! 🚀 National People's Congress Deputy Wu Hanqi, who's also chairman of tech giant CITIC Heavy Industries, called for 'multidimensional support' to turbocharge AI development during key policy discussions this week.

'AI isn't just changing the game—it's rewriting the rulebook for factories,' Wu told CGTN. He highlighted how smarter machines could boost efficiency, slash costs, and create next-gen jobs that blend human ingenuity with robot precision. 🤝💡

This push comes as China aims to stay ahead in the global tech race 🌍🏁, with policymakers debating everything from research funding to workforce training. For young entrepreneurs and investors, it's a signal: AI-driven manufacturing could be the next big playground for innovation.
